Key Highlights of the Successful Rollout of Rule-38
The implementation of Rule-38 marks a significant milestone, achieved through meticulous planning, cross-team collaboration, and continuous system enhancements. The rollout was executed smoothly with strong stakeholder involvement, ensuring operational readiness and user confidence across all stages.
📌 Comprehensive Testing and Improvements
The system underwent three complete rounds of User Acceptance Testing (UAT). Each round incorporated feedback from users and stakeholders, resulting in continuous refinements and improved system stability before final deployment.
🔗 Seamless System Integrations
Rule-38 was successfully integrated with critical enterprise systems, including:
-
Master Data Management (MDM)
-
Roster
-
Personnel Information System (PIS)
-
Learning Management System (LMS)
These integrations ensured data consistency, automation, and reduced manual intervention throughout the process.
🔄 End-to-End Workflow Enablement
A fully automated and traceable end-to-end workflow was enabled, covering:
Vacancy → Application → Verification → Result → Relieving → Joining
This streamlined approach significantly improved transparency, reduced turnaround time, and minimized operational dependencies.

📊 Rule-38 Movement Summary
Inter-Circle Transfers
| Cadre/Type | Count |
|---|---|
| LSGSBCO | 1 |
| MTS | 20 |
| PA | 745 |
| PA LSG | 26 |
| PACO | 38 |
| PASBCO | 1 |
| PM | 34 |
| SA | 216 |
| STENO GRADE II | 3 |
| Total (Inter) | 1084 |
Intra-Circle Transfers
| Cadre/Type | Count |
|---|---|
| MG | 8 |
| MTS | 241 |
| PA | 1380 |
| PM | 229 |
| SA | 209 |
| Total (Intra) | 2067 |
Grand Total
3151 candidates successfully processed under Rule-38
